Gallery House B&B Review

by Steve A » Wed Feb 03, 2010 7:58 pm

Realizing that practically all readers of HotBytes reside in Louisville, a review of a bed and breakfast might not seem terribly useful here. That said, some of you might have friends or relatives coming to town and need a place for them to stay. Have I found the place for them!

For starters, booking a room is a breeze as this particular B&B has an easily-navigated presence on the web that lets you view room options (there are three), check availability and book your selection online. For us that process went smoothly, and we chose their western themed room.

Arriving in Louisville, we found the Gallery House location to be easy to find. They are situated in an Old Louisville neighborhood a stone's throw from historic St. James court with convenient on-street parking.

Upon check in we were greeted by innkeepers Leah and Gordon, and found them to be gracious and accommodating hosts. Though it is in a new building, the B&B is impeccably decorated to match the charm of a period home. The artwork on all the walls is a feast for the eyes, and the furnishings are modern and comfortable. Barbara and I found our room to be a comfortable size with en suite bath (ours was a shower only, the other rooms had tubs). The rooms are well equipped with cable television, small fridge, clock radio, phone, iron and ironing board. Most importantly, the bed was very comfortable and every night we enjoyed a good night's sleep.

Since the second "B" in B&B stands for breakfast, this review would not be complete without mention of our morning meal. Each morning we were given the choice of hot cereal, an egg dish or batter-based dish. In the vernacular of the day, all I can say is OMG. On different days we had omelets, scrambled eggs, waffles, pancakes and hot oatmeal. The eggs were perfectly cooked, but for me the real standouts were the pancakes. On one day I was treated to a creation of the house called pineapple upside down pancakes. These were served with a tangy syrup made from pineapple juice, and at the same time were both sweetness and light. Another day I enjoyed berry pancakes that had a hint of lemon. The pancakes were consistently light and fluffy, and along with a cup of their coffee a perfect start to our day.

All in all, at the Gallery House Bed and Breakfast the combination of a comfortable room, wonderful hosts, delicious breakfasts, and reasonable room rates made for a most pleasant stay.
